Apple Outlines Key Features To Look For When Upgrading From Airport Devices

Now that Apple’s AirPort line is dead, Apple has now published a new support document detailing what customers should be looking for when upgrading from their existing AirPort devices. While Apple’s AirPort devices never support mesh networking, Apple recommends using such a setup if you have a larger home. Apple also recommends getting a router that supports 802.11ac, simultaneous dual-band networks (2.4GHz and 5GHz), WPA2 Personal (AES) encryption, and MIMO or MU-MIMO which allows the router to send and receive multiple streams which improves performance....

Apple Fixes Bug That Let Users Begin Macos Big Sur Installation Without Enough Space Available

It was reported last week that macOS Big Sur has a serious issue that can result in data loss when users try to upgrade a Mac to the latest version of the operating system without enough space available. Apple has finally fixed the issue with a new build of macOS Big Sur 11.2.1, which properly checks if the disk has the required space before starting the upgrade process. Mr. Macintosh first reported that several users were getting an error message when upgrading a Mac computer to macOS Big Sur, which caused the Mac to no longer boot — and the only solution was to delete some files from the internal disk via Target Disk Mode (which doesn’t work for some models) or to wipe the entire disk....
